OASIS Mailing List ArchivesView the OASIS mailing list archive below
or browse/search using MarkMail.

 


Help: OASIS Mailing Lists Help | MarkMail Help

docbook-apps message

[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]


Subject: Re: [docbook-apps] Simpler XHTML output


Rene Hache wrote:

> Please reply, comment make suggestions. I have never written something
> this nature but willing to get the ball rolling.
> 
> 1. The XHTML output will comply with the W3C XHTML 1.1 recommendation,

Using XHTML 1.1 is not good idea because:

1) it must be labelled as MIME type text/xml, application/xml or 
application/xhtml+xml per specification

2a) XML parser in IE chokes on XHTML DTD when page is served as text/xml

2b) IE doesn't render page when it is sent as application/*, in this 
case IE offers saving to file

Pragmatical approach is to use XHTML 1.0 that can be labelled as 
text/html when HTML compatibility mode is used.

> 5. The only DIV to be created inside the main content will be for
> admonitions, sidebar and highlights.

Why? That way you will not be able to control rendering of whole section 
or titlepage for example. Current stylesheets wrap these structures 
inside <div class="section"> or <div class="titlepage"> respectively.

-- 
------------------------------------------------------------------
   Jirka Kosek     e-mail: jirka@kosek.cz     http://www.kosek.cz
------------------------------------------------------------------
   Profesionální školení a poradenství v oblasti technologií XML.
      Podívejte se na náš nově spuštěný web http://DocBook.cz
        Podrobný přehled školení http://xmlguru.cz/skoleni/
------------------------------------------------------------------

S/MIME Cryptographic Signature



[Date Prev] | [Thread Prev] | [Thread Next] | [Date Next] -- [Date Index] | [Thread Index] | [List Home]